The Tampa Bay Buccaneers will be without safety Antoine Winfield Jr. for their upcoming game against the Atlanta Falcons, marking his fourth consecutive game missed due to an ankle sprain sustained in Week 1. Although he participated in a limited practice on Wednesday, it remains uncertain if he will be ready for the following week's game against New Orleans. Additionally, defensive tackle Calijah Kancey has also been ruled out for Week 5 due to a calf injury, continuing his absence for the season.
